>>>> With the introduction of the ISA_BUS_API Kconfig option, ISA-style
>>>> drivers may be built for X86_64 architectures. This patch changes the
>>>> ISA Kconfig option dependency of the PC/104 drivers to ISA_BUS_API, thus
>>>> allowing them to build for X86_64 as they are expected to.
